How they compare

Timor-Leste currently reports 96 t against 82 t in Guinea-Bissau, a difference of 14 t.

That makes Timor-Leste's figure about 1.2 times Guinea-Bissau's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Guinea-Bissau ahead.

Guinea-Bissau ranks 133rd and Timor-Leste ranks 131st of 216 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Guinea-Bissau averaged higher in 3 and Timor-Leste in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Guinea-Bissau Timor-Leste Difference Ahead
1990s 16 t 2 t 14 t Guinea-Bissau
2000s 77.9 t 4.1 t 73.8 t Guinea-Bissau
2010s 82 t 26.8 t 55.2 t Guinea-Bissau
2020s 82 t 87.2 t 5.2 t Timor-Leste

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ains statistics on the agricultural use of major pesticide groups and of relevant chemical families. Data are disseminated by country, with global coverage and are updated annually. The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ains information on the use of major pesticide groups:1. Insecticides (Chlorinated hydrocarbons, Organo-phosphates, Carbamates-insecticides, Pyrethroids, Botanical and biological products and Others not elsewhere classified);2. Mineral Oils;3. Herbicides (Phenoxy hormone products, Triazines, Amides, Carbamates-herbicides, Dinitroanilines, Urea derivatives, Sulfonyl urea, Bipiridils, Uracil, Others not elsewhere classified);4. Fungicides and Bactericides (Inorganic, Dithiocarbamates, Benzimidazoles, Triazoles, Diazoles, Diazines, Morpholines, Others not elsewhere classified);5. Plant Growth Regulators;6. Rodenticides (Anti-coagulants, Cyanide Generators, Hypercalcaemics, Narcotics, Others not elsewhere classified);7. Other Pesticides NES (not elsewhere specified).
